Analysis
Albania recorded 1.64 kg CO2eq/kg for meat of cattle with the bone, fresh or chilled — emissions intensity in 2023. That is the lowest value across all 63 years on record.
The figure is down 33.0% on the previous year and down 78.3% over ten years.
Over the whole period, meat of cattle with the bone, fresh or chilled — emissions intensity in Albania peaked at 97.18 kg CO2eq/kg in 1964 and was at its lowest, 1.64 kg CO2eq/kg, in 2023.
Albania ranks 184th of 189 countries on this measure, in the bottom quarter.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The FAOSTAT domain on Emissions intensities contains analytical data on the intensity of greenhouse gas (GHG) emissions by agricultural commodity. This indicator is defined as greenhouse gas emissions per kg of product. Data are available for a set of agricultural commodities (e.g. rice and other cereals, meat, milk, eggs), by country, with global coverage.
